Stevia with Rice - A Delicious and Healthy Recipe
Preparation time: 20 minutes
Cooking time: 30 minutes
Total time: 50 minutes
Number of servings: 4

Necessary ingredients:
- 6 bunches of fresh stevia (make sure they are green and crispy)
- 2 bunches of green onions (choose young onions for a milder taste)
- 1 bag of Uncle Ben’s rice (whole grain for added fiber and flavor)
- 1 teaspoon of dried thyme (for a fragrant accent)
- Salt, olive oil (or other preferred oil), and 2 tablespoons of broth (for a rich taste)
Preparation steps:
1. Preparing the ingredients
Start by washing the stevia well. It is essential to remove any impurities, so use cold water and gently rub the leaves. Once cleaned, cut the leaves from the stem. This step is important to ensure a pleasant taste without tough fibers.
2. Boiling the stevia
In a large pot, bring water to a boil. Add a pinch of salt. When the water is boiling, add the stevia and let it boil for 3-4 minutes. This will help soften the leaves and extract the flavors.
3. Cooking the rice
In another container, boil the rice in the bag according to the package instructions. Usually, for whole grain rice, a boiling time of about 20-25 minutes is recommended. Ensure that the rice becomes fluffy and not sticky.
4. Cooking the onions
In a large saucepan, add 2 tablespoons of oil and the finely chopped green onions. Sauté the onions over medium heat until they become translucent, about 5-7 minutes. This process will enhance the onion's flavor and add more taste to your dish.
5. Adding the ingredients
Once the stevia is boiled, remove it from the water and chop it finely. Add the chopped stevia to the saucepan with the onions, along with 2 tablespoons of broth. Mix well to combine the flavors.
6. Combining the rice with the stevia
Remove the rice from the bag and add it to the saucepan. Also add dried thyme to taste. Carefully mix all the ingredients to ensure the rice is evenly distributed.
7. Baking
Preheat the oven to 180 degrees Celsius. Transfer the mixture to a baking dish and bake for about 15-20 minutes, until it reduces slightly and forms a light golden crust on top. This step will intensify the flavors and give an appetizing appearance to the dish.
8. Serving
Once the dish is ready, remove it from the oven and let it cool slightly. Serve it warm, alongside a fresh vegetable salad or creamy yogurt, which will perfectly complement the taste of the stevia.
Useful tips:
- Choosing the stevia: Choose leaves that are green and firm. Wilting or yellowing leaves can affect the final taste of the dish.
- Variations: You can add feta cheese or mozzarella on top of the dish before baking for a creamy touch. You can also use basmati rice or wild rice instead of whole grain rice, depending on your preferences.
- Pairing with other dishes: This recipe pairs perfectly with grilled chicken or fish. You can also accompany the dish with a glass of dry white wine, which will highlight the natural flavors of the stevia.

Frequently asked questions:
1. Can I use frozen stevia?
Yes, you can use frozen stevia, but make sure to thaw and drain it well before adding it to the dish.
2. What other vegetables can I add?
You can experiment with spinach, nettles, or even zucchini to add variety and texture to the dish.
3. How can I store leftovers?
The dish stores well in the refrigerator in an airtight container for 2-3 days. It can be reheated in the microwave or oven.
